Simpler criteria for finite-copy implementability

Develop simpler necessary or sufficient conditions to decide whether a given positive map Λ admits a completely positive N-copy extension Λ_N for some finite N, beyond the eigenvalue-based characterization via the symmetrized Choi operator and the specific sufficient and necessary conditions provided in the paper.

Background

The authors provide a full characterization: Λ is N-copy implementable if and only if the symmetrized N-copy extension Λ_Nsym is completely positive, which reduces to checking the minimum eigenvalue of a specific operator. They also derive two sufficient and one necessary condition to facilitate verification.

Despite these results, they explicitly state that finding simpler criteria than those currently available remains an open direction, indicating a desire for more tractable tests or characterizations for practical use.
